VB.NET自动加载宏

来源:互联网 发布:小区车辆出入数据 编辑:程序博客网 时间:2024/06/06 03:44

VB.NET自动加载.xla文件

Public Function Loadxla(ByVal xlaPath As String, ByVal load As Boolean) As Boolean        Dim loaded As Boolean = False        Try            If (File.Exists(xlaPath)) Then                Dim o As Object                o = XlApp.AddIns.Add(xlaPath, True)  '定义成object,add by danielinbiti                o.Installed = load                loaded = o.Installed            End If        Catch            loaded = False        End Try        Loadxla = loaded    End Function

调用如

Loadxla("E:\selfh.xla", True)

Xlapp为Excel.Application对象


0 0